What is Scrum?

Scrum is an agile framework used to implement complex projects. Scrum was established for the creation of the software projects, but is best used to deal with the growing complexity of projects.

The role of a Scrum Master

The Scrum Master is the person who assists Scrum. The Scrum Master is accountable for removing problems to the abilities of a team to convey product purposes. They are the person who acts as a wall between the product goals and any barriers that may arise.

Responsibilities of Scrum Master:

  • They help the Product Owner and make sure that the important work is understood by all team members.
  • They guide teams using Scrum methodology
  • They simplify self-organisation
  • They help remove weaknesses for the purpose of work progression

The role of Scrum Product Owner:                

The Scrum Product Owner is a key stakeholder. The Product Owner recognises product provisions and ensures team members understand them. The PO follows the Scrum project framework and is usually the first user of the product. The PO is very much aware of the marketplace and the competition.

Responsibilities of a Product Owner:

The responsibilities of a Product Owner are:

  • Product backlog: the Product Owner has to create and maintain the backlogs as the full-time activity. As technology advances and things keep changing, it is vital to keep an eye on the ball. The backlog is to be groomed before presented into the Sprint planning training.
  • The business values: the PO has the responsibility to schedule the backlog before the planning meeting. The scheduling of a delay means the relative importance orders the user stories.
  • Contributions with the amplification of Epics, Themes, and Features into user stories: The PO should establish a clear vision of the user requirements to the team members, so the PO should be present during the elaboration of user stories.
  • Delivers the vision and goals: the Product Owner should remind the team about the objectives of the project. This approach will keep all the team members on track.
  • Dealing with the customers and the stakeholders: the Product Owner must invariably involve the client and stakeholders to guarantee the construction of the right product. The Product Owner has the responsibility to direct the team when direction changes.
  • Contributes to planning meetings and Sprint reviews: in an organisation, various processes are in execution, so it is quite easy for a PO to excuse the meetings, but these meetings should go ahead to give other Scrum ceremonies the chance to inspect and adapt.
  • Reviews the product progress at the end of every Sprint: during the requirement of rescheduling the work, the PO should analyse the things and make necessary changes.
  • Alterations in a project: the Product Owner has complete control of the project and can direct the team in an entirely different direction. The team members should have trust in their PO and calmly welcome the suggested changes.
  • Communicates status: the PO is a voice of team members. They always make sure that communication is open to all the channels, and that projects have the right amount of support.
  • Terminates a Sprint if required: if there is a need to end the project, then the Product Owner can make this happen.
